#1678b3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1678b3 is composed of 8.6% red, 47.1%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.7% cyan, 33%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 202.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.1% and a lightness of 39.4%. #1678b3 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cf0ff with #000067.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1678b3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1678b3 has RGB values of R:22, G:120, B:179 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 1472691.
